[8], 6, [2], 921, [5] p. plate : ill. port. 8vo. Provenance: MS. on flyleaf: Vjth Form Class – Prize to Kenneth Grahame from Algernon Barrington [Swiern?] St Edward School. Oxford. July 1875; gilt armorial centrepiece on covers: Saint Edwards School Oxford; Not indigenous No NT ink stamp. Property of the Dorneywood Trust. Binding: Nineteenth-century sheep over boards on four recessed cords plus five false raised bands, gilt spine tooling, red spine label, double gilt fillet with inner blind dotted border roll and gilt armorial centrepiece on covers, gilt roll on board edges, blind roll on board inners, marbled edges to match endpapers.
